Oral Implants: Permanent Restore Your Smile



Dental implants have turn into a preferred choice for people seeking to switch missing teeth. However, a concern that usually arises is whether or not these implants could cause sinus problems. Understanding the anatomy of the mouth and the sinuses can make clear this concern, as well as the varied components that contribute to such complications.
When dental implants are positioned within the upper jaw, they might come into shut proximity to the maxillary sinuses. These sinuses are positioned above the upper teeth and could be affected in the course of the implant procedure. The process usually involves drilling into the jawbone to insert the titanium submit that can function the dental implant root. If this is not carried out with precision, it’s possible for the implant to protrude into the sinus cavity.


One main issue that can contribute to sinus problems is the health of the jawbone. If there might be important bone loss in the area where the implant is being positioned, the surgeon could need to conduct a bone graft. This can increase the chance of issues, including potential issues with the maxillary sinuses, as the graft material might penetrate the sinus house.


Even if the bone is deemed sufficient for the implant, there can nonetheless be risks associated with surgery. The insertion of an implant creates a minor surgical wound. As with any surgical procedure, there is a risk of infection. If an infection occurs within the space surrounding a dental implant, it might doubtlessly unfold to the sinus cavity, leading to sinusitis or different complications.

Some patients can also expertise sinus-related signs post-surgery that mimic sinusitis but are not because of an precise infection. This condition is known as post-operative sinusitis. Symptoms could embody nasal congestion, facial pain, or stress. The discomfort is likely related to irritation or irritation in the tissues of the sinus, rather than an actual infection.


To mitigate the risks of sinus issues throughout dental implant surgery, a thorough pre-operative assessment is crucial. Dentists sometimes use imaging techniques, similar to CT scans, to judge the relationship between the higher jaw and the maxillary sinuses. This helps in figuring out the exact placement of the implants without invading the sinus space.


Another important consideration is the experience and ability of the dental surgeon performing the implant. A certified and skilled practitioner is much less prone to lead to complications. Advanced training in dental surgery reinforces methods that can decrease risks associated with sinus problems.

What are the potential causes of sinus problems after dental implants?

Sinus issues can come up if the dental implant is placed too high, encroaching on the sinus cavity. This can result in infections or sinusitis. Proper imaging and planning during the implant procedure are important to minimize risks.


How can I know if my sinus problems are related to my dental implants?

Symptoms similar to nasal congestion, pain within the sinus area, or drainage could indicate a connection. Consulting along with your dentist for an evaluation, together with X-rays, may help determine if the implants are a contributing issue.


What should I do if I suspect my dental implants are inflicting sinus issues?

Contact your dentist instantly. They can assess your situation, carry out necessary tests, and supply therapy choices if the implants are certainly affecting your sinus health.


Are some individuals more in danger for sinus problems with dental implants?

Yes, individuals with pre-existing sinus conditions, similar to chronic sinusitis or a historical past of sinus infections, may be at larger risk. Personal medical history must be discussed with the dentist before the process.


What preventive measures can be taken to keep away from sinus problems throughout dental implant placement?


Using advanced imaging applied sciences like cone beam CT scans helps ensure accurate placement of the implant. Additionally, an skilled oral surgeon will consider the anatomy of the sinus in the course of the procedure.


How typically do sinus problems happen following dental implant surgery?

While sinus problems are relatively uncommon, they'll happen in a small proportion of circumstances. Proper planning and placement significantly reduce the probability of those issues.


Can a sinus lift process alleviate the risk of sinus issues after getting an implant?


Yes, a sinus carry can raise the sinus ground and implant the bone graft to create more space for the implant. This process may scale back the chance of sinus complications in certain circumstances.
